Duncan William UPHILL

Regimental number3734
Place of birthMount Gambier, South Australia
ReligionPresbyterian
OccupationFarmer
AddressMount Schanck via Mount Gambier, South Australia
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ation28
Height5' 8"
Weight148 lbs
Next of kinFather, W J B Uphill, Mount Schanck via Mount Gambier, South Australia
Previous military serviceNil
Enlistment date24 November 1917
Place of enlistmentMount Gambier, South Australia
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name9th Light Horse Regiment, 34th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number10/14/5
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board SS Port Darwin on 30 April 1918
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ll9th Light Horse Regiment
FateEffective abroad (still overseas)
Miscellaneous information from
  cemetery records
Parents: William and Margaret UPHILL
Discharge date26 August 1919
Other details

Commenced return to Australia on board HT 'Oxfordshire', 10 July 1919; disembarked Adelaide, 10 August 1919; discharged (termination of period of enlistment), Adelaide, 26 August 1919.

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
Date of death19 December 1924
Age at death36
Place of burialAIF Cemetery (Row 6 West, Grave No. 15), West Terrace, Adelaide, South Australia
SourcesNAA: B2455, UPHILL Duncan William
